Senior Rails Engineer Are you looking for an opportunity to contribute to a company with a powerful mission? At HAAS Alert, we're building life-saving mobility solutions to create a connected, collision-free world where everyone gets home safely. Every day, roadway hazards result in numerous collisions, injuries, and deaths. Our innovative Safety Cloud platform delivers digital alerts directly to drivers, up to 30 seconds before they reach a hazard, giving them crucial time to react. This technology is rapidly expanding its reach, protecting emergency responders, roadway workers, and the public. About Us HAAS Alert is dedicated to making roads and communities safer and smarter. We've experienced incredible growth, expanding from 138 to over 2,500 customers in just two years, and we continue to grow. By connecting thousands of emergency fleets and millions of passenger vehicles, we're actively reducing collisions, injuries, and deaths. We're also committed to giving back to the communities we serve through our GiveBack program, supporting emergency responders, roadway workers, and their families. Primary Responsibilities: We are looking for a Senior Rails Engineer to join our fast-growing team. As a senior contributor, you’ll help lead the development and scaling of our Safety Cloud® platform using Ruby on Rails. You’ll work closely with a talented group of engineers, designers, and product managers to build critical backend services and APIs that power real-time vehicle-to-vehicle and vehicle-to-infrastructure communication. • Design, build, and maintain scalable Ruby on Rails applications and APIs •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to define, design, and ship new features • Optimize application performance, scalability, and reliability • Conduct code reviews and advocate for best practices • Participate in architectural discussions and help shape the technical roadmap • Write clean, well-tested, and maintainable code • Troubleshoot production issues and implement sustainable fixes • Integrate third-party services and APIs as needed Experience: • 5+ years of professional experience with Ruby on Rails in a production environment • Strong understanding of PostgreSQL or similar relational databases • Experience building RESTful APIs and working with JSON and webhooks • Familiarity with background processing frameworks (Sidekiq, Resque, etc.) • Proficiency with code repositories and branching • Strong understanding of software architecture, design patterns, and testing practices • Excellent communication and collaboration skills • Passion for public safety or transportation innovation Brownie Points: • Experience with real-time systems, geospatial data, or telematics • Familiarity with AWS or cloud infrastructure • Experience with Docker and CI/CD pipelines • Contribution to open-source projects or technical blog posts • Previous experience in a startup or fast-paced product environment Must live in the city of Chicago! • Hybrid, Full-Time Position • Although only 2 days are required to be in-office (Tuesday/Wednesday) you are welcome to use our space to work whenever you'd like. We have an excellent neighborhood office space in the Lincoln Park area with free street parking. • Base salary of 130k - 170k per year, depending on experience • 40 hours per week • Unlimited PTO • Stock Options • Health, Dental, Vision insurance Job Type: Full-time Pay: $130,000.00 - $170,000.00 per year Benefits: • Dental insurance • Health insurance • Paid time off • Vision insurance Work Location: In person
